This podcast series explores the deep ties between music, culture, and literature, highlighting the traditions that shape Europe's heritage. From the melodies woven into Władysław Reymont's Nobel Prize-winning novel Chłopi (The Peasants) to jazz-folk fusion and modern reinterpretations, each episode examines how the past inspires contemporary art and identity, revealing timeless beauty and meaning.

HajdaBanda is a band that draws inspiration from the rich musical traditions of three Slavic nations. Through their creative efforts, they weave these diverse cultures into a cohesive tapestry, uncovering both their shared roots and distinctive differences. Piotr Damasiewicz is a renowned jazz artist whose work boldly draws inspiration from the richness of cultural heritage. Deeply rooted in the exploration of native traditions, he reimagines their potential in innovative and authentic ways. His dedication to collaboration shines through his eagerness to work with individuals connected to local heritage, creating a vibrant space for joint creativity and the exchange of ideas.
